Rapid Response Operatives (Grounds Maintenance & Street Cleansing) Location: Warwick and towns/villages across Warwickshire Hourly Rate: £13.31  Contract type: Permanent, full-time. Working hours: 40 hours. Wednesday to Sunday, 10:00-18:00 About the role Are you seeking a new opportunity to train with a motivated team? Are you dedicated to ensuring the cleanliness of your local communities' environment? If so, we have an exciting opportunity for you to join our Warwick team as a Rapid Response Operative! The successful candidate will assist in maintaining the cleanliness across Warwickshire by performing a varied range of tasks (both, scheduled & on a call-response basis) such as basic repairs & maintenance, removing hazards, clearing areas and generally making sure areas are clean and safe. For the right candidate, we can look to provide training/ upskilling in chainsaw usage and spraying licenses (PA1/ PA6).
